Call for Applications: Research Trip to South India

CALL FOR APPLICATIONS!

This 3-week research trip will allow undergraduate students to gain some understanding of environmental conservation and food sovereignty grassroots movements in South India. Through visits to a forest preserve (Gurukula Botanical Sanctuary), organic farms and food cooperatives (Navadarshanam, Timbaktu Collective), students will explore alternatives - environmental and collective - to rapid climate change, capitalism, and urbanization.

When: May 15- June 8, 2024
